Chris Kobin

Chris Kobin is an American screenwriter and film producer .

job

Chris Kobin took his first steps in the film business with television. He made his debut on the 1997 TV film Terrorized by Police as a producer. In 1999 he worked as co- executive producer on the documentary The Girl Next Door and a year later as executive producer on A Vision of a Murder . In 2004 he produced his documentary Slasher for John Landis . The following year, Chris Kobin wrote the script for the 2001 horror comedy Maniacs . In 2006 he wrote and produced Driftwood . He also wrote a script segment for Snoop Dogg for his film project Hood of Horror . In 2010 he wrote the screenplay for the sequel to 2001 Maniacs 2001 Maniacs 2 - It's Done and produced the documentary Hollywood Don't Surf! . From 2011 to 2013 he was executive producer on the reality show Flipping Vegas .

Others

  • Chris Kobin always worked with director Tim Sullivan on his script projects.
  • He used to work as a car dealer.
  • Kobin wrote five songs for the 2001 Maniacs soundtrack . For the sequel to 2001 Maniacs 2 - It's Done , he wrote three titles.
  • Kobin made an appearance on the reality show Bodog Music Battle of the Bands .
